    This thesis investigates hard choices—decision-making cases in which an agent’s options are incommensurable—and what their rise and resolution reveal about practical reason, the self, and human and non-human agency. I develop my arguments on three distinct but connected levels: the formal structure of hard choices, the mechanisms underlying them, and the practical reasons involved.
